What’s the Biggest Husqvarna Chainsaw? The 3120XP

The Husqvarna 3120XP is the biggest Husqvarna chainsaw — a 118.8cc, 8.4-HP powerhead typically run with a 24-42 inch bar for felling, though dealers sell it with bars up to 72 inches for chainsaw milling. That’s a professional-only tool: at nearly 23 lbs (powerhead alone) with no chain, it’s built for loggers and arborists, not occasional homeowner use. Key Specifications

Before we delve into the performance of the largest Husqvarna chainsaw, let’s take a look at its key specifications. Designed to tackle the most demanding cutting jobs, this powerhouse of a chainsaw boasts impressive features that set it apart from the rest.

Model Engine Displacement Bar Length Weight (powerhead)
Husqvarna 3120XP 118.8cc 24-42 in. (felling); up to 72 in. (milling) 22.9 lbs

As the table shows, the 3120XP packs a 118.8cc, 8.4-HP engine and runs bars as long as 72 inches for milling setups, per Husqvarna’s official spec sheet. At 22.9 lbs for the powerhead alone (before bar, chain, and fuel), it’s noticeably heavier than homeowner-class saws — a trade-off for the extra displacement.

Safety Features

Husqvarna is known for producing powerful and reliable chainsaws, but they also prioritize user safety. The biggest Husqvarna chainsaw is equipped with advanced safety features to prevent accidents and provide innovative user protection.

Preventing Accidents

Husqvarna’s largest chainsaw models are designed with safety in mind. Automatic chain brake systems are integrated to stop the chain in the event of kickback, reducing the risk of injury. Additionally, the inertia-activated chain brake ensures that the chain stops immediately when the saw encounters a sudden movement.

Real-World Applications

In forestry and logging, saws in this class tackle large-diameter trees that smaller homeowner saws can’t safely fell. They’re built for professional tree-felling and limbing operations, and the 72-inch milling bar option is specifically for chainsaw milling — cutting a felled log lengthwise into lumber on-site.

Choosing the Right Husqvarna for the Job

The 3120XP isn’t the right choice for most homeowners — its weight and power are overkill (and overspend) for yard cleanup or firewood cutting. It makes sense specifically for milling, felling very large-diameter trees, or professional forestry work where a smaller saw would bog down.
